Hey Priya — handing off the flaky DNS thing on Brambleloop staging. Resolution fails maybe one in forty lookups, always against the internal resolver, never the fallback. I bumped the cache TTL and it helped but didn't fix it. Next step is tweaking the resolver order. Current settings for reference below.

deployment values, yahag-tawef:
ZORWYN_HOST=zorwyn.tolvaqlabs.internal
ZORWYN_PORT=9300

Subject: Harlow Bay franchise agreement — signed

Team, good news: the Pinewhistle Café franchise agreement for the Harlow Bay region closed yesterday. Finance, please set up the royalty schedule (6% of net sales, quarterly) and the initial fee invoice. Onboarding kicks off next month. The confidential note below covers the rollout plan.

board note of tawip-hahip: Only 7 of the 80 pilot accounts renewed Ralath, so a churn review is set for April 1.

Ticket: Staging env misconfigured for Siftgate bloom filter

The bloom layer in front of the Pellet KV store is rejecting all lookups in staging because the env file was copied from the dev template without credentials. False-positive tuning values are fine; only the auth line is missing. To unblock the weekly demo, the Pellet admission secret must be set on the following line.

env line for yaguf-fajop: LEDGER_TOKEN13=fb08984397349

## Env Vars: Orders Soft Deletes

For this week's sync: the Merlot orders service now soft-deletes rows via a deleted_at column. SOFT_DELETE_RETENTION_DAYS (default 90) governs when the purge job hard-deletes. Set PURGE_DRY_RUN=true in staging until QA signs off. The purge job connects to the archive database with its own credential, which is set on the following line.

secret setting of hawep-yahig: LEDGER_TOKEN29=41b5d6315371c92885eaeb077fb63

Subject: DR drill — InvoiceForge renderer, Thursday

Welcome aboard. Thursday's drill simulates total loss of the InvoiceForge PDF rendering cluster in the Dunmere region. Your role: restore the renderer from the cold snapshot, verify font embedding, and confirm a test invoice renders identically to the golden copy. You'll need access to the sealed restore account, which stays dormant outside drills. Do not reset it; doing so invalidates the escrow. The account's recovery passphrase is recorded below.

vault phrase of kajop-kaweg = sorix-istys-noviel